1/2 Stuiver
Issuer | Nijmegen, City of |
Year | 1619-1620 |
Type | Standard circulation coin |
Value | 1/2 Stuiver (1⁄40) |
Currency | Silver Gulden (1560-1795) |
Composition | Billon |
Weight | 1 g |

Reference(s) | Ver#24.4, KM#34 |
Obverse description | Crowned coat of arms of Nijmegen divides value. |
Obverse script | Latin |
Obverse lettering | MO NO CIVI NOVIM
Q S (Translation: New Money of the City of Nijmegen 1/2 Stiver) |
Reverse description | Long open cross with lettering on its quarters |
Reverse script | Latin |
Reverse lettering | H S V N
BEA GNS CV D SPS E (Translation: Half Stiver of Nijmegen Happy people whose hope is the Lord) |
